Feature #10366: New inspection form for rational

Currently, rational inspection is expressed with parentheses:
(2/51)
If this were taken as a Ruby expression, it would mean integer division, whose value is `0` in this case. It does not make much sense to express that it is indeed not integer division and that it is rational by using parentheses. Now that we have rational literal using `r`, we can make the inspection form as:
2/51r
This would be much less confusing.
